I wondered about this. The most prominent church in Dunkeld is (and would have been) the Cathedral.

I found this on the web:

http://www.heartlander.scotland.net/gallery/..%5Cdac%5Cbook_Story_15.htm

An earlier Bishop, James Bruss (Bruce), appointed to the See in 1441, was sadly troubled with the Struan cateran "Robert Reoch Macdonoquhv," who was a scourge to the church and caused "plunder the church lands of Little Dunkeld." It has been suggested that it might have been these godless invaders and not the law-abiding parishioners who are thus alluded to in the local rhyme so often quoted in derision—

I think that the idea of it being related to aftermath of the '45 fits... There's a verse that mentions Geordie and Charlie.
